TECH PLAY

PowerShell」に関連する技術ブログ

167 件中 151 - 165 件目
技術開発部セキュリティユニットの星野です。 前回の 「Black Hat USA 2019 / DEF CON 27に参加してきました」 では、それぞれのイベントの概要とおすすめの歩き方についてご紹介しました。 今回は、そのうちBlack Hat USA 2019の詳細な内容についてご紹介します。 前回も述べたとおり、Black Hatの中で行われるイベントは主にトレーニング、ブリーフィング、ビジネスホールの3つがあります。その3つのうち、私が参加したトレーニングの内容と、聴講したブリーフィングの一部をご
こんにちは、MasaKuです。 今年も オープンソースカンファレンス が開催されましたので、毎年の恒例行事として参加してきました! www.ospn.jp 以前参加した際に、興味深かった発表の 記事 を書かせていただいたり、弊社で行っているビアバッシュで発表しました。 tech-blog.rakus.co.jp しかし、そもそも、 オープンソースカンファレンス ってどんなところ?と思われる方も多いのではないでしょうか。 今回は、 オープンソースカンファレンス ならではの楽しさをお伝えし「 参加してみたい!
こんにちは、技術3課の城です。 先日、Amazon Elasticsearch Service(以降、AES)にVPC Flowlogsのデータを投入するという内容のブログ記事を書きました。 今回はこのAESを用いてアラート機能を用いて時間当たりのリジェクトの異常発生を検知、Slack投稿する、というのをやってみたいと思います。 1.前提条件 AESにVPC Flowlogsのデータが投入できていること 2.SlackのIncomming Webhookの用意 こちらの当社ブログの「PowerShellが
こんにちは、開発部の鶴見です。 ZOZOTOWNのリプレースを担当しています。 ZOZOTOWNリプレースですが、オンプレからクラウドに単純に置き換えるのでなく「運用が楽になる」などメリットを考えながら作り替えています。 主にデータベースは、AzureのRDBである SQL Database を利用しています。 先日までSQL Databaseのパフォーマンスとコストがネックになっていました。そこでAzure Automationを利用しSQL Databaseを定期的にスケールアップ/ダウンさせリソース
こんにちは。開発部の廣瀬です。 本記事では、ZOZOTOWNを裏側から支えているバックオフィスシステムにおけるトラブルシューティング事例をご紹介したいと思います。 尚、今回の話題はバックオフィスシステムで使用しているVBScript言語がメインとなります。WebサーバーはIIS、DBMSはSQL Serverを使っている環境です。 ZOZOTOWNのバックオフィスシステムについて ZOZOTOWNのバックオフィスシステム(以後、BOと呼ぶ)では、顧客管理や物流管理などを行っています。 BOの開発はすべて弊
技術4課の鎌田(裕)です。 CloudWatchのメトリクス、マネジメントコンソールで確認される方は多いと思いますが、メトリクスをコマンドラインで取得したいケースもあると思います。 色々な都合でAWS CLIとPowerShellの両方を比較しながら取得したかったのですが、意外と同じデータを取れる情報が並べて書かれている記事がなかったので、こちらのブログでは、AWS CLIとAWS Tools for PowerShellの両方の方法を記載します。 必要なパラメータ CloudWatchの概念(https
技術4課のPowerShellおじさんこと、鎌田です。社内でPowerShellを実装できる人が増えてきたので、ちょっと焦りも感じつつ。 先のブログで、LambdaをPowerShellで実装しデプロイまでを解説しました。 せっかくLambdaをPowerShellで実装できる準備をしたので、SlackのBotを実装してみることにしました。 PowerShellがSlackに投稿するための準備 Slackに対してPowerShellが投稿するためには、Slack側でIncoming WebHooksのUR
技術4課のPowerShellおじさんこと、鎌田です。 先のブログで、PowerShellでLambdaを実装するための準備をしました。さあいよいよ、実装していきましょう。 1.実装の基礎知識 PowerShell Lambdaを実装する時は、専用コマンドでテンプレートからスターターコードを作成し、テンプレート中にあるファイルを編集して、実装します。 テンプレートは以下のコマンドで種類を確認できます。 Get-AWSPowerShellLambdaTemplate いくつかありますが、Basicでまずは実
技術4課のPowerShellおじさんこと、鎌田です。 日本、いや全世界のPowerShell大好きな皆様、PowerShell使いだって、サーバーレスしたいですよね? Pythonのコードを書いたことがある私でも、PowerShellでサーバーレスしてみたいぞ!ということで、LambdaがPowerShellの実装に対応したことを記念し、実際に実装してみたいと思います! まずは環境準備が大事!ということで、環境作りから進めましょう! 0.前提 本ブログは、AWS上に構築したEC2に、Lambdaをデプロ
技術4課の鎌田(裕)です。 マネジメントコンソールでのアクセス時にSwitch Roleを使いこなしてらっしゃる方は多いかと思います。 しかし、コマンドベースでお使いの方はなかなか少ないかも知れません。 この記事では、PowerShellでIAM RoleにSwitchして、作業をする時の方法と、必要な準備をご紹介します。 手順としては、以下の流れになります。 IAMユーザーを作る IAMユーザーにSwich Roleの権限だけを与える 実際の作業をする時の権限を持ったIAM Roleを作る PowerS
コマンドラインでRoute 53を操作したい プロフェッショナルサービス課の杉村です。既存のDNSサーバRoute 53に移行したいときなど、一度にたくさんのゾーンとレコードをRoute 53に登録したいケースがあると思います。残念ながらRoute 53関連のAWS CLIやAWS Tools for PowerShellはあまり充実しておらず、手慣れたBashやPowerShellでスクリプトを書こうとしても壁にあたってしまいます。そこでgithubで公開されているcli53というツールを使ってみること
技術一課の鎌田(兄)です。 Windows10ベースのWorkSpaces、皆さんはもうお使いですか? このWindows10ベースのWorkSpaces、日本語版のバンドルがリリースされているのは良いのですが、日本語化が不完全なため、PowerShellなどを起動すると、残念ながら英語のUIで起動してきます。 また、キーボードが英語キーボードの設定のため、@のキーの場所が異なるなど、何かと戸惑います。 この記事では、WorkSpacesの日本語になりきっていない部分を、とことん日本語化したいと思います。
技術一課の鎌田(兄)です。 みなさん、EC2のインスタンス作成の際、UserDataをご活用かと思います。 Linuxではbash、WindowsだとPowerShellで書ける訳ですが、Windowsの場合、管理者権限を求められた上に、ポップアップで許可をしないと進めない、というケースがあります。 直近でも、「Windowsインスタンスが起動する時に、ローカルの管理者権限を持ったローカルユーザーを追加して欲しい!」なんてリクエストがあったのですが、こちらのブログで成果を公開したいと思います。
こんにちは,エンジニアの久保です。 先月開催された Microsoft Build 2017 では,Bash on Windows で, これまでの Ubuntu のほかに, Fedora と openSuSE の サポートが発表 されました。 この機能は,2017 年秋にリリース予定の Windows 10 Fall Creators Update に含まれるようです。楽しみですね。 今回は,現在利用可能な Bash on Ubuntu on Windows について,Windows 10 Creato
AWS Lambdaを使えばサーバレスでシステム構築ができます。最近ではそうしたサーバレスなシステムをサーバレスアーキテクチャとして人気があります。今回はそんなサーバレスアーキテクチャを実現するためのサービスを紹介します。 AWS Lambda (サーバーレスでコードを実行・自動管理) | AWS 最も有名なのがAWS Lambdaでしょう。1ヶ月100万回までのリクエストが無料で、その後も低料金で処理ができます。Java、Node.js、Pythonがサポートされています。 Functions | Mi